A good alternative to seeing a hypnotherapist is self hypnosis. To practice this, you need to find a time and place when you are not likely to be disturbed. Make sure you are comfortable. Either sit on a chair or sofa or lie on the floor. Support your head. Fix your eyes on an object at eye level and try to remove all thought from your mind.
Focus on your breathing. Take slow deep breaths. It is best to inhale through your mouth and exhale through your nostrils. While concentrating on your breathing, begin to relax your body. You can start with your toes and progressively relax your entire body by slowly moving up until you reach the head. See yourself going down a staircase and imagine you are going down into a deeper and deeper sleep with every step you take down.
When you are satified that you are in a good relaxed sleep, anchor this happy state by associating it to a specific object or word. If you continue to practice this, one day you will be able while fully awake to reproduce this relaxed state by thinking about this object or word.

At the end of the self hypnosis session, it is time to wake up. You do this by counting up from one to five and tell yourself that as you count up, so you are gradually waking up and at five you will wake up and will be wide awake, calm and relaxed. Keep doing your self hypnosis session regularly and the more you do it, the better you be get at it.
